This was a definite challenge. It was built during covid, and we faced all kinds of issues with supply shortages, a three-week concrete strike, and a shortage of storage space due to their basement being renovated. The client had a drawing of the design, but we needed to come up with actual plans to make it work.
To further complicate things, we had to build the shed in the fall so it could be used for temporary winter storage. Then we poured the slab the next year and moved the shed but hand onto it. That is not bad, considering it was 16' x 10' and weighed close to a 1000 lbs.
